📝 Color Information for #0BEF9F

The hexadecimal color code #0BEF9F represents a medium shade in the cyan family. In the RGB color model, this color is composed of 11 red, 239 green, and 159 blue, which translates to approximately 4% red, 94% green, and 62% blue. This makes it a highly saturated color with cool undertones that can evoke different emotional responses depending on its application. When analyzed in the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) color space, #0BEF9F has a hue of 159 degrees, a saturation level of 91%, and a lightness value of 49%. The hue angle of 159° places this color firmly in the cyan spectrum. In the HSV/HSB color model, this translates to a hue of 159°, saturation of 95%, and brightness/value of 94%. For print applications using the CMYK color model, #0BEF9F would be reproduced using 95% cyan, 0% magenta, 33% yellow, and 6% black. The closest web-safe color is #00FF99, which may be useful for ensuring compatibility across older displays and systems. This color works well in various design contexts. With its medium lightness, it's versatile enough for both foreground elements and subtle backgrounds. The high saturation makes this color vibrant and attention-grabbing, ideal for call-to-action buttons, highlights, and accent elements. When pairing #0BEF9F with other colors, consider its complementary color at hue 339° for maximum contrast, or use analogous colors within 30° of its hue for harmonious combinations. The decimal representation of this color is 782239, which can be useful in certain programming contexts.

What is the CMYK value of #0BEF9F? +

The approximate CMYK value of #0BEF9F is C:95% M:0% Y:33% K:6%. CMYK (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, Key/Black) is the color model used in physical printing. Unlike RGB which mixes light additively on screens, CMYK mixes inks subtractively on paper. Note that the RGB-to-CMYK conversion is an approximation — screen colors and print colors exist in different color gamuts, and some screen colors cannot be exactly reproduced in print. For precise print work, consult a professional print color profile or Pantone matching system.
